-V-SD servo drivers can monitor SERVOPACK and motor status through MECHATROLINK-III communi-
cations.
Monitor information can be used to help determine the cause of alarms, as maintenance information, and in
many other useful ways.
Monitor information can also be used to draw the path of a motor axis to easily view the results of servo
adjustments.
The host controller does not necessarily have to provide the ability to display monitor information, but this
function can be very useful in many situations. You must determine in advance what types of monitor infor-
mation to use, what GUIs to display, and what type of path tracing to perform on the host controller.
The primary functions are as follows:
• Servo tracing
• Path drawing (circular arc paths)
• Tapping synchronization accuracy drawings
• I/O monitoring
Selecting Monitor Information
Σ
-V-SD servo drivers can constantly monitor a variety of SERVOPACK information.
Select the information to monitor in the monitor selection fields.
For common and optional monitors, the information to monitor is selected with a parameter.
A maximum of six different types of monitors can be obtained through a combination of main commands and
